Ashley Elusma, Visiting Student in Research with InterGEN for the fall 2016 semester, was recently admitted to the YSN Graduate Entry in Prespecialty Nursing (GEPN) program!  The prestigious YSN GEPN program is the first of a three-year, full-time course of study that combines preparation in basic nursing with advanced preparation in a clinical specialty. Ashley has been admitted to the Pediatric Nurse Practitioner (PNP) specialty.
